The Developer shall pay to the City a public facilities fee in an amount not to exceed 2% of the bu.ilding permit valuation of the building or structures to be constructed .in the Development pursuant to the Request. The fee shall be paid prior to the issuance of building or other construction permits for the development and shall be based on the valuation at that time. This fee shall be in addition to any fees, dedications or improvements required pursuant to Titles 18, 20 or 21 of the Carlsbad Municipal Code. Developer shall pay a fee for conversion o f existing building or structures into condominiums in an amount not to exceed 2% of the building permit valuation at the time of conversion. The fee for a condominium conversion shall b.e paid prior to the issuance of a condominium conversion permit as provided in Chapter 21.47 of the Carlsbad Municipal Code. Condominium shall include community apartment or stock cooperative. The Developer may offer to donate a site or sites for public facilities in lieu of all or part of the financial obligation agreed . upon in Paragraph 1 above. .If Developer offers to donate a site or . sites for public facilities, the City shall consider, but is not obligated to accept the offer. The time for donation and amount of credit against the fee shall be determined by City prior to the issuance of any building or other permits. Such determinati'on,,when . * made, shall become a part of this agreement. Sites donated under this paragraph shall not include improvements required pursuant to Titles 18 or 20 of the Carlsbad Municipal Code. 3. This agreement and the fee paid pursuant hereto.are required to ensure, the consistency of the Development with the City's General Plan. 'If the fee is not paid as provided herein, the City will not have the funds to provide public facilities and services,. and the development will not be consistent with the General Plan‘and any approval or permit for.the.Development shali be void. No building or other construction permit or entitlement for use shall be issued .until the-public facilities fee required by this agreement is paid. 4. City agrees to deposit the fees paid ,pursuant to this agreement in a public facilities fund for the financing of public facilities when the City Council determines the need exists to provide the facilities and. sufficient funds from the payment of this and similar public facilities fees are available. . 5.
